Output ed21dd8e0e383784cfb78b5aeedc6768902b54ff2d93c9e44471952a30139f8b:0

value
280445776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eb2914a138d153b8ec56cbe591c40bb56fbdf7 OP_EQUAL
address
ME6HDX3VhyZNJjMAvaYSJ4aJxoPgeWqvmf
transaction
ed21dd8e0e383784cfb78b5aeedc6768902b54ff2d93c9e44471952a30139f8b
spent
true